Are you intrigued by the idea of cute bunnies with a dark twist? Then you're in for a treat with our latest art podcast episode featuring Madison-based illustrator Sara Christenson from Bunny Attack Illustration. Sara's unique pen and ink drawings of rabbits are not your ordinary fluffy creatures; they're a blend of adorable and eerie, reflecting life's complexities in the most unexpected ways.

Sara's journey into the world of art began with a simple illustration of an owl, inspired by the natural patterns of a piece of wood. This moment of inspiration led her down a path of exploration with Prismacolor pens, eventually focusing on their true passion—rabbits. But these aren't just any rabbits. They embody a spectrum of emotions, from the fierceness of her own pet rabbit, Evie, to the humor and depth that Sarah brings to her work.

You'll learn about Sara's creative process, from the initial spark of an idea to the meticulous stippling technique that brings their illustrations to life.
